The interview process for the National Defense Academy (NDA) varies depending on the stage of the selection process. Here's a general idea of what you can expect during the SSB (Service Selection Board) interview:n
1. Stage 1: Written Test - This test includes subjects like General Knowledge, Mathematics, and English. You'll need to score well in this test to proceed to the next stage.n
2. Stage 2: Psychological Tests - These tests assess your psychological suitability for military service. They include tests like the Thematic Apperception Test (TAT), Word Association Test (WAT), and Situation Reaction Test (SRT).n
3. Stage 3: Personal Interview - This is a one-on-one interview with an officer who will assess your leadership potential, communication skills, motivation, and general personality.n
4. Stage 4: Group Discussion/Group Tasks - These activities are designed to evaluate your teamwork, decision-making abilities, and adaptability under pressure.n
5. Stage 5: Conference - A panel of officers will review your performance in all stages and decide whether to recommend you for the NDA.
